Latest Patents

John Dougherty holds 2 patents. His latest patents include "Colloidal gold nanoparticles on anodic alumina oxide substrates for surface-enhanced Raman scattering." This patent discloses a preparation method for colloidal gold nanoparticles deposited using a wet-chemical, three-phase ligand-exchange procedure at room temperature on anodic alumina oxide. This innovation enhances the detection of materials using Surface-enhanced Raman Scattering (SERS). Another notable patent is "Methods to detect trace levels of genetic materials using colloidal gold nanoparticles on quartz paper or metamaterial substrates and surface-enhanced Raman scattering." This patent describes the use of colloidal gold nanoparticles on quartz paper or metamaterial substrates to enable trace level detection of biological materials, such as genetic materials, using SERS.
